Saturday, November 7
Nursing scrubs..a quilt?
I retired from nursing in January. We had a garage scale and attempted to sell my scrubs...but no buyers. I spent a few days cutting them up for fabric in future quilt projects. I ran across the "no name block and decided they would be perfect. Nice remembrance of my nursing in home health. Here is the result.
I found a fabric that I might use in the Allietarecherith mystery. Scrubs in Cherith's quilt....perfect.
